Ingredients of Fafda
-
Prepare 1 cups of besan / gram flour.
-
Prepare to taste of salt.
-
You need 1/4 tsp of ajwain / carom seeds.
-
Prepare 1/4 tsp of baking soda / papad kharo.
-
You need 2 tbsp of oil.
-
You need of water to knead dough.
-
It’s of oil for deep frying.

Fafda instructions
-
Firstly, in a large mixing bowl add in 1 cups besan, ¼ tsp ajwain, ¼ tsp baking soda / papad kharo and salt to taste..
-
Add 2 tbsp oil and mix well..
-
Further add warm water as required and knead..
-
Knead for 5 minutes or till the dough turns soft and smooth..
-
Add a tsp oil and coat the dough well..
-
Cover with bowl and rest for 30 minutes..
-
Knead again for a minute making sure the dough is soft..
-
Pinch a ball sized dough and make a cylindrical shape..
-
On a wooden board place the dough and stick one side..
-
Press and stretch it thin with the help of palms in forward direction..
-
Scrape off with the help of knife without damaging the fafda..
-
Now deep fry in hot oil. do not over crowd the fafdas as they wont cook well..
-
Stir occasionally keeping the flame on medium..
-
Fry fafdas for a minute or two, till they turn golden and crispy..
-
Ready for serve. Serve with fry green chilli and kadhi.
